<?php
/**
* HTML API: WP_HTML_Stack_Event class
*
* @package WordPress
* @subpackage HTML-API
* @since 6.6.0
*/
/**
* Core class used by the HTML Processor as a record for stack operations.
*
* This class is for internal usage of the WP_HTML_Processor class.
*
* @access private
* @since 6.6.0
*
* @see WP_HTML_Processor
*/
class WP_HTML_Stack_Event {
/**
* Refers to popping an element off of the stack of open elements.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*/
const POP = 'pop';
/**
* Refers to pushing an element onto the stack of open elements.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*/
const PUSH = 'push';
/**
* References the token associated with the stack push event,
* even if this is a pop event for that element.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*
* @var WP_HTML_Token
*/
public $token;
/**
* Indicates which kind of stack operation this event represents.
*
* May be one of the class constants.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*
* @see self::POP
* @see self::PUSH
*
* @var string
*/
public $operation;
/**
* Indicates if the stack element is a real or virtual node.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*
* @var string
*/
public $provenance;
/**
* Constructor function.
*
* @since 6.6.0
*
* @param WP_HTML_Token $token Token associated with stack event, always an opening token.
* @param string $operation One of self::PUSH or self::POP.
* @param string $provenance "virtual" or "real".
*/
public function __construct( WP_HTML_Token $token, string $operation, string $provenance ) {
$this->token = $token;
$this->operation = $operation;
$this->provenance = $provenance;
}
}
